Updating is disabled

I just installed Sophos Anti-Virus for Mac Home Edition and the "Update Now" option is grayed out. When I look at the log, it appears that I'm running virus definitions that are a week old. Is seems to be that updating is broken altogether. Are manuals updates required or is something broken in my installation?

  • Did a complete uninstall of Version 7 on my 500 mghz PowerBoook (G3 PPC) running Mac OS 10.4.11, did perfectly clean download and install of Version 8 (restarted, corrected permissions, etc.)... within 5-10 mins max of running, it shuts off AutoUpdate and displays an "x" within the Sophos icon at the top of the screen. Sophos log shows nothing unusual, but system's Console log reports that AutoUpdate CRASHED. Restarting the computer results in a complete replication of the problem EVERY time (i.e. at first Sophos icon appears properly - with "S" in it - but shortly thereafter the "S" is replaced with an "x" and the system's Console log reports that AutoUpdate crashed again).

    Anybody have any ideas or suggestions? I've looked through this board's site but don't see anything directly related to this issue; maybe it's a bug specific to PPC's (or G3 PPC's) running 10.4.11???
